Uses of Class
net.finmath.montecarlo.interestrate.products.components.AbstractPeriod
Packages that use AbstractPeriod
Package
Description
Provides a set product components which allow to build financial products by composition.
-
Uses of AbstractPeriod in net.finmath.montecarlo.interestrate.products.components
Subclasses of AbstractPeriod in net.finmath.montecarlo.interestrate.products.componentsMethods in net.finmath.montecarlo.interestrate.products.components with parameters of type AbstractPeriodModifier and TypeMethodDescriptionAccruingNotional.getNotionalAtPeriodEnd(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
Notional.getNotionalAtPeriodEnd(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
Calculates the notional at the end of a period, given a period.NotionalFromComponent.getNotionalAtPeriodEnd(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
NotionalFromConstant.getNotionalAtPeriodEnd(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
AccruingNotional.getNotionalAtPeriodStart(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
Notional.getNotionalAtPeriodStart(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
Calculates the notional at the start of a period, given a period.NotionalFromComponent.getNotionalAtPeriodStart(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
NotionalFromConstant.getNotionalAtPeriodStart(AbstractPeriod period, TermStructureMonteCarloSimulationModel model)
Constructors in net.finmath.montecarlo.interestrate.products.components with parameters of type AbstractPeriodModifierConstructorDescriptionAccruingNotional(Notional previousPeriodNotional, AbstractPeriod previousPeriod)
Creates a notion where the notional of the period start is calculated as the notional of the previous period's period end and the notional at period end is calculated as being accrued via getCoupon on the current period.